πŸ”¬ Research & Projects

Physics & Simulations

  • Active Droplet Propulsion under Chemical Reaction
    • Simulated LLPS in binary fluids using Active Model H.
    • Implemented spectral methods to solve coupled PDEs in Python.
  • Monte Carlo Simulations of the Ising Model
    • Implemented the Metropolis Algorithm in Python.
    • Verified phase transitions and scaling laws in 2D/3D models.
  • Ensemble Simulations
    • Microcanonical ensemble showing Maxwell velocity distribution.
    • Canonical ensemble Lennard-Jones fluids and observed phase transitions.
